Reclaiming Childhood Joy and Adventure
Many adults have lost touch with the passions and joys they once experienced, becoming overly focused on responsibilities and routines. Activities that once brought excitement—such as mountain biking, traveling, or writing poetry—often fall by the wayside as life becomes busier and more complex. To revive enthusiasm, individuals are encouraged to reassess what activities once brought them joy and to reincorporate those experiences into their lives. This return to playfulness and adventure is essential for rediscovering happiness and fulfillment.
Fighting Entropy Through Novelty
The concept of entropy refers to the natural tendency of systems to move toward disorder, which can parallel the loss of passion and adventure in adult life. To combat this decline, it is advised to introduce novelty and unexpected changes into everyday routines, such as taking a new route to work or trying different cuisines. Engaging in new activities not only enriches one’s experiences but also stimulates the brain, which thrives on novelty. Maintaining a childlike spirit and sense of playfulness can lead to greater joy and a more vibrant life.
